Why an Early Survey Changes the Whole Job

Because in a converted building the lift capacity and the route out decide the crew size, and neither can be established from a desk count over the phone.

Most businesses call once the lease is agreed, which is when the least time is left for the parts that need the most. A survey and a written figure cost nothing and tie you to nothing.

Original goods lifts in mill buildings are frequently smaller than people assume, and some floors are served by a staircase alone. That is not a problem, but it decides whether a job needs four people or six, and getting that wrong is what makes an evening overrun. Knowing it weeks ahead also allows the lift to be booked where the building manages access centrally.

Crates arriving early let staff clear their own desks over several days rather than in one rushed afternoon. If the lease date moves we rebook without charge given reasonable notice, and a quote does not lock you into one service level, so you can compare packing yourselves against having it done and decide nearer the time.

What Decides the Cost of a Halifax Office Move

Gradients and Goods Lifts Do the Real Work Here

The volume, the route out of each building, and the window you pick. Around Calderdale the route is the one that swings the number most.

Volume is counted at the survey and it is the straightforward half. Desks, storage, IT, stock and archive are listed, and counting properly is what makes a fixed figure possible instead of an estimate that climbs once the work starts.

Gradients and goods lifts do the real work here

Two things shape a Halifax move more than anything else. The first is the buildings: a great deal of office space sits in converted mills where the lift is original, the doorways were cut for machinery rather than furniture, and the floors are wide but the access to them is not. The second is the ground itself. Streets running off the town centre drop away sharply, which means the nearest legal parking spot can be well above or below the entrance, and a loaded trolley cannot be pushed safely on a steep slope.

Both are entirely manageable and both change the crew rather than the method. A longer or steeper carry is solved by having more people making shorter trips, so the job still finishes inside the agreed window. What causes trouble is quoting without looking, then discovering on the evening that the van cannot get within thirty metres of the door.

The survey covers the route as well as the rooms, at both addresses. Nobody from your side needs to measure a lift, count steps or check what the street allows.

Why the Crate Label Names a Desk, Not a Drawer

Materials Ahead of the Date, Collected After It

Because a crate marked with a destination is carried once and set down correctly, while a crate marked with its contents still needs someone to decide where it belongs.

Each person packs their own desk into their own numbered crate, which takes around twenty minutes and keeps everyone belongings separate. What is written on the crate identifies a spot on the destination drawing instead of listing the contents. Crates stack square on a trolley for the level runs and lift two-handed where a trolley cannot go, which matters on a stairwell or a sloping approach, and they shut without tape so nothing spills in transit. They arrive at your office well before the date and go back to us once the business is running again.
